80-402. Same; accounts; exhibit at annual meeting. The township treasurer shall keep a true account of all moneys by him or her received by virtue of his or her office, and the manner in which the same have been disbursed, keeping a separate account with each fund, electronically or in a book to be provided at the expense of the township for that purpose, and shall exhibit such account, together with his or her vouchers, to the township auditing board at their annual meeting on the last Saturday of October in each year for adjustment and settlement. History: G.S. 1868, ch. 110, § 27; L. 1885, ch. 168, § 12; L. 1886, ch. 140, § 3; L. 2007, ch. 39, § 3; July 1. Attorney General's Opinions: Township treasurer; duties. 82-104. CASE ANNOTATIONS 1. Treasurer and sureties are liable for moneys deposited in suspended bank. Rose v. Douglas Township, 52 Kan. 451, 452, 34 P. 1046.
